About this event

Please join us for an in-person information session to learn more about MxD—where innovative manufacturers come to forge their futures.
During this session, you’ll have the opportunity to take a staff-led tour of our facility, including the MxD Factory Floor, our experiential manufacturing environment designed to demonstrate and experiment with advanced digital manufacturing technologies. You’ll also learn more about the benefits of MxD membership, including access to workshops, networking events, and collaborative project opportunities.
In partnership with the U.S. Department of Defense, MxD helps equip U.S. manufacturers with the digital tools, technologies, and expertise needed to build every part better than the last. Today, more than 300 partners collaborate with MxD to increase productivity, strengthen supply chains, and win more business.
Please register using the link provided. If you’re unable to attend this month’s session, check back for additional dates. We host these sessions regularly based on interest.

For safety on the manufacturing floor, please avoid loose clothing. Closed-toe shoes are required to participate in the facility tour.
